Company Description
For over a century, the Australian British Chamber of Commerce has been the leading independent organisation promoting, fostering and furthering bilateral relations between Australia and the United Kingdom.
With strong, longstanding ties to the Australian and UK business communities and their respective governments, we provide direct networking opportunities across the breadth of industry sectors. We assist you in making meaningful, mutually beneficial connections to support your business goals.
Our domestic event calendar, along with our International Catalysts, direct introductions, public policy contributions and marketing efforts align to stimulate interest and action in the areas of energy transition and renewables; national security and defence; financial and professional services; AI, cyber and tech; and much more.
Role Description
The Event Manager is responsible for the end-to-end planning, coordination, and delivery of ABCC events. This includes networking events, business forums, panel discussions, corporate briefings, and signature events. The role ensures events are professionally delivered, aligned with the Chamber's objectives and provide strong value to members, sponsors, and partners.
Key Responsibilities
Event Planning & Delivery
* Plan, coordinate, and deliver a calendar of ABCC events from concept to delivery
* Manage logistics including venues, catering, AV, speakers, registrations, and run sheets
* Ensure events are delivered on time, on budget, and to a high professional standard
Stakeholder & Partner Management
* Liaise with members, sponsors, speakers, venues, and suppliers
* Support sponsor engagement and ensure agreed sponsor deliverables are met
* Coordinate with internal teams to align event objectives
Budget & Administration
* Prepare event budgets and track costs
* Manage invoicing and supplier payments
* Maintain accurate event records and post-event reporting
Marketing & Communications Support
* Work with the marketing team to promote events via email, website, and social media
* Assist with event collateral including invitations, programs, signage, and presentations
* Manage event registration systems and attendee communications
On-the-Day Event Management
* Oversee event setup, registration, speaker coordination, and pack-down
* Act as the main point of contact during events to resolve issues quickly and professionally
